The fuel metering valve is typically located in the fuel rail or the fuel line, close to the fuel injectors. It is controlled by the engine control unit (ECU), which receives signals from the sensors to determine the optimal fuel-air mixture for combustion.
By adjusting the fuel flow, the metering valve ensures that the engine receives the correct amount of fuel at any given time, depending on factors such as engine load, speed, and temperature. This helps to optimize fuel efficiency, reduce emissions, and improve overall engine performance.
If the fuel metering valve becomes faulty or clogged, it can cause issues such as poor fuel economy, rough idle, or engine misfires. In such cases, the valve may need to be cleaned, repaired, or replaced by a qualified mechanic.
